Recently, Digital Science unveiled its latest AI patent study results, shedding light on the current state of affairs in the AI race. Among the notable findings, IBM emerges as a frontrunner, leading the pack ahead of tech giants Google and Microsoft, signaling an intensification in the pursuit of next-generation AI capabilities.
